Vada is a popular South Indian snack made from lentil or legume batter that is deep-fried to create a crispy and savory fritter. It is typically enjoyed with chutneys or sambar.

Instructions
 

  • Soak the urad dal in water for about 4-6 hours. Drain the water and grind the dal into a smooth paste using a little water as needed.
  • Transfer the dal paste to a mixing bowl and add chopped onions, green chilies, curry leaves, grated ginger, and salt. Mix well to combine.
  • Heat oil in a deep frying pan. Wet your hands with water, take a small portion of the batter, shape it into a flat disc with a hole in the center to form the vada, and carefully slide it into the hot oil.
  • Fry the vadas on medium heat until they turn golden brown and crispy. Remove from the oil and drain on paper towels to remove excess oil.
  • Serve the vadas hot with coconut chutney or sambar.
